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,830 in Taipa versus $1,209 in Tbilisi.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,886 in Taipa versus $1,867 in Tbilisi.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,941 in Taipa versus $2,526 in Tbilisi.

Living in Taipa is roughly 51% more expensive than Tbilisi,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

The two cities straddle the global median: Taipa is 37% above, Tbilisi is 10% below.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,222 in Taipa and $693 in Tbilisi.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Dining out: $49.00 in Taipa vs $43.00 in Tbilisi for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$317 vs $203 per month, with Tbilisi cheaper across the board.
